Naturally occurring alkaloid derived from the dried ripe seeds of Sabadilla (Schoenocaulon officinale). Now largely obsolete. |
|
Mainly used to control thrips and other mites but shows some activity against other pests such as harlequin bugs, squash bugs, blister beetles, fleas |
|
Citrus; Avocado; Mangos; Non-food and external areas |

Non-systemic. Works by binding to voltage-gated sodium ion channels, preventing their inactivation, which leads to increased nerve excitability and intracellular calcium concentration |
|
The seeds of the Schoenocaulon officinale plant are harvested when they are fully mature. The active compounds, known as sabadilla alkaloids, are extracted from the seeds. This is typically done using solvents to create a concentrated extract. The extract is then purified to remove any impurities and concentrate the active ingredients. The purified extract is formulated into various products. |
